Closseum. How Europe is creating sovereign AI infrastructure and why it is important for Ukraine
In 2024, iGenius, a startup with deep technical roots in Italy, unveiled a project that has become a true symbol of Europe's digital independence - Closseum, one of the world's largest data centres for artificial intelligence. The success of this project is the result of a strategic alliance with NVIDIA and Vertiv, and most importantly, it shows that artificial intelligence and data security can coexist. How Europe is creating sovereign AI infrastructure and why it is important for Ukraine.
Colosseum is a next-generation data centre located in Southern Italy. It is based on NVIDIA GB200 NVL72, a platform that combines 72 Blackwell GPUs and 36 Grace CPUs in a hyper-efficient liquid-cooled system. A purpose-built central AI deployment platform for processing large models, including LLM (Large Language Models) and AGI (Artificial General Intelligence). This system is the flagship of NVIDIA's new architecture and a true ‘engine’ for processing artificial intelligence models containing billions or even trillions of parameters.
But even the most powerful processor is only hardware, and it needs a stable, reliable, and intelligent infrastructure. And that's where Vertiv and the NVIDIA software ecosystem come in.
In a project of this magnitude, stability is paramount. Vertiv provided the Colosseum with a full range of solutions that turned the tech giant into a reliable data fortress:
- Uninterruptible Power Supply (UPS): Power redundancy systems with multi-level redundancy and scalability.
- Liquid cooling: Critical for GPU-intensive clusters, it helps to maintain optimal temperatures at lower power consumption.
- Centralised monitoring: platforms that monitor every watt and every degree in real time.
Thanks to Vertiv, the Colosseum's infrastructure is not only technologically advanced, but also 100% fault tolerant, which is critical for AI.
Another key player in this story is NVIDIA Mission Control. This is an intelligent data centre management platform that coordinates the operation of hardware, software, AI workloads, and even the physical environment, including:
- Automatic resource balancing between training and processing AI model requests.
- Flexible scaling depending on the needs.
- Integration with power and cooling systems - taking into account efficiency and costs.
- Customised to meet industry needs: from financial institutions to medical research.
Mission Control is a centralised control panel that ensures the synchronised operation of all data centre components in real time. It takes automation and control to a new level.
This project is not just a technology showcase. It is a clear benchmark for countries seeking digital sovereignty. And that is why Colosseum is important for Ukraine.
We have a great demand for secure AI infrastructure, especially in the defence sector, financial industry, government agencies, and telecoms. But most importantly, Ukrainian businesses and the government are increasingly seeking to store data on their own territory, have control over its processing, and reduce dependence on global cloud giants.
Colosseum is proof that local AI infrastructure can be powerful, secure, and meet the highest standards.
